An sIB algorithm for automatically determining parameter

To solve the problem of determining the compression variable parameter for sIB algorithm, this paper proposes an AsIB algorithm for automatically determining parameter based on minimum description length principle. An efficient encoding scheme is designed to estimate the description length of the solution model of sIB algorithm and the original data given the model respectively, and the minimum description length model is selected as a criterion to find the number of feature patterns hidden in dataset. Experiment results show that the encoding scheme in AsIB is efficient to recover the true feature pattern in dataset without the requirement of setting category number of feature pattern. AsIB algorithm removes the dependency of empirical knowledge for sIB algorithm, which widens its applications in areas such as automatic dimension reduction and pattern extraction, etc.
